Answer: 1) Ethos: B) appeal to values/morality; 2) Logos: A) Appeal to reason; 3) Pathos: C) appeal to emotion.

Explanation: When writing, an author can use several rhetorical devices in order to persuade, inform or impact the audience in the desired way. Three of the must used rhetorical devices are ethos, logos, and pathos. Ethos is an appeal to the audience's ethics, logos is an appeal to the audience's logic and pathos is an appeal to the audience's emotions. So the correct answers are 1: B; 2: A; and 3: C.
